- Use Consistent Branding: Maintain a uniform color scheme and typography throughout the email to reinforce brand identity.
- Prioritize Clarity: Ensure content is easy to read and understand by keeping sentences concise and paragraphs short.
- Incorporate Engaging Visuals: Add high-quality images that complement the message and grab attention.
- Include a Strong Call-to-Action: Provide a clear and compelling call-to-action to guide the reader's next steps.
- Implement Responsive Design: Ensure emails are optimized for both desktop and mobile devices for better user experience.
- Apply Personalization Techniques: Use customer data to tailor content to individual preferences and needs.
- Perform A/B Testing: Test different elements such as subject lines and visuals to identify what resonates best with your audience.
- Ensure Easy Navigation: Use a logical structure and include important links and buttons to facilitate easy navigation.
